Manually Scan for a Wi-Fi Network 
1.  From the Home screen, tap 
➔ Settings ➔ Wi-Fi
2.   Tap  Scan.  
All available Wi-Fi networks are displayed.

Wi-Fi Advanced Settings 
The Advanced Wi-Fi menu allows you to set up many of your 
device’s Wi-Fi service, including: 
• 
Network notification when an open network is available 
• 
Setting your Wi-Fi sleep policy 
• 
Checking for Wi-Fi Internet service 
• 
Automatically connecting to an AT&T Wi-Fi hotspot when detected 
• 
Specifying your Wi-Fi frequency band 
• 
Viewing your device’s MAC and IP Address

Wi-Fi Direct 
Wi-Fi Direct allows device-to-device connections so you can 
transfer large amounts of data over a Wi-Fi connection.
